PROPERTY SUMMARY: The heart of the home is a magnificent open-plan kitchen/living/dining space - perfect for entertaining or relaxed family living. Flooded with natural light through bi-fold doors to the south and west elevations, this space is as functional as it is stylish, with two wood-burning stoves (including a feature Dik Geurts Odin), solid oak floors, a hand-built shaker-style kitchen with quartz worktops, twin Neff ovens and a Quooker tap.

Adjoining this space is a sitting room with glazed doors opening directly onto the rear patio-an ideal spot to enjoy the evening light and take in the breath-taking sunsets over the surrounding countryside.

Tucked off the hallway is a fully fitted utility room and a separate cloakroom.

A versatile study enjoys views over the gardens and farmland beyond, while all four double bedrooms benefit from vaulted ceilings, fitted wardrobes and contemporary en-suites. The principal suite is particularly impressive, offering dual-aspect windows, a walk-in dressing area and a luxurious bathroom with freestanding tub and walk-in shower. Throughout, there is zoned underfloor heating via an air source heat pump, double glazing, and thermostats in every room for maximum comfort and efficiency.

OUTSIDE Set behind electric wrought-iron gates, the property enjoys a wonderfully secluded approach. A shingle driveway provides ample parking and leads to a double cart lodge, detached garage and a fully fitted workshop/studio-ideal for those looking to work from home or pursue creative hobbies.

The grounds are a key feature of the property, with mature trees, well-stocked borders, expansive lawns and a beautiful west-facing pergola that lends itself perfectly to al-fresco cooking and dining. Beyond the gardens, a wildflower meadow stretches northwards and extends the total plot to approximately 3.5 acres (subject to survey).

Whether you're seeking sanctuary from city life or the perfect base for hybrid working, Jackamans Farm offers a rare combination of contemporary luxury and rural lifestyle-within easy reach of everything you need. Offered with no onward chain.

SERVICES: Mains Water, electricity. Air source heat pump under floor heating. Private drainage via treatment plant.

LOCAL AUTHORITY: Mid Suffolk District Council - Band G.

EPC RATING: D

BROADBAND AND MOBILE: FTTP 900mbs, superfast broadband, Please see our website and Ofcom.org.uk for further details
